STV is seeking a Digital Delivery Specialist to join our Digital Advisory department at our New York City, NY office.

Responsibilities:

  • Lead and oversee the implementation and management of Building Information Modeling (BIM) strategies across complex, multi-disciplinary projects.

  • Develop and enforce BIM standards, execution plans, and quality control processes to ensure model integrity and coordination.

  • Collaborate with project leadership, design teams, and consultants to integrate BIM workflows into overall project delivery and lifecycle management.

  • Guide model federation, data validation, and model-based coordination meetings using tools such as Autodesk Construction Cloud, Revit, and Navisworks.

  • Mentor and support internal teams and clients on digital delivery best practices, model optimization, and technology integration.

Qualifications:

  • Minimum 6 years of professional experience in BIM management within large-scale infrastructure or vertical construction projects.

  • Expert-level proficiency with Autodesk Revit, Navisworks, ACC, and related BIM technologies.

  • Proven ability to lead BIM efforts across multi-phase programs, including design, construction, and turnover phases.

  • Strong leadership, organizational, and client-facing communication skills.

  • Bachelor's degree in architecture, engineering, construction management, or a related field preferred.

Compensation Range:

$128,289.89 - $171,053.19
